Nail-biting, or onychophagia, is a common nervous habit often linked to stress and anxiety. While Lexapro (escitalopram), a selective serotonin reuptake inhibitor (SSRI), is primarily prescribed to treat generalized anxiety disorder (GAD) and depression, its impact on anxiety levels may indirectly affect nail-biting tendencies. By reducing anxiety, Lexapro could theoretically diminish the urge to bite nails, as the habit often serves as a coping mechanism for stress. However, individual responses to medication vary, and some users report increased restlessness or nervousness during the initial weeks of treatment, which might temporarily exacerbate nail-biting.

Analyzing the mechanism, Lexapro works by increasing serotonin levels in the brain, promoting emotional stability and reducing anxiety symptoms. For adults, the typical starting dose is 10 mg daily, which may be adjusted up to 20 mg based on response and tolerance. Adolescents aged 12–17 are often started on 10 mg, with no recommended increase. If anxiety decreases significantly, the compulsive behaviors associated with it, such as nail-biting, may subside. However, this is not a direct side effect of Lexapro but rather a potential secondary outcome of its primary action on anxiety.

To address nail-biting while on Lexapro, consider pairing medication with behavioral strategies. For instance, habit-reversal training involves identifying triggers and replacing nail-biting with a less harmful action, like squeezing a stress ball. Additionally, keeping nails trimmed and applying a bitter-tasting polish can deter the habit. If restlessness occurs during treatment, consult a healthcare provider; they may recommend adjusting the dosage or adding a complementary therapy, such as cognitive-behavioral therapy (CBT), to target both anxiety and nail-biting.

Coping Mechanisms: Discuss strategies to manage nail-biting while on Lexapro, focusing on behavioral interventions

Nail-biting, or onychophagia, can intensify for some individuals while on Lexapro, potentially linked to the medication's impact on serotonin levels or stress reduction, which may paradoxically increase nervous habits. While Lexapro (escitalopram) is primarily prescribed to manage anxiety and depression, its side effects can vary widely among users. For those experiencing nail-biting as a behavioral response, targeted interventions can help disrupt the cycle. Behavioral strategies, rather than relying solely on medication adjustments, offer practical and immediate tools to address the habit.

One effective approach is habit reversal training (HRT), a behavioral technique designed to replace nail-biting with a competing response. Start by identifying triggers—boredom, stress, or specific environments—and note when the urge arises. For example, if nail-biting occurs during work breaks, replace the action with squeezing a stress ball or stretching your hands. Consistency is key; practice the alternative behavior every time the urge surfaces. For adolescents or adults, pairing this with a visual reminder, like wearing a silicone wristband, can enhance awareness and accountability.

Another strategy involves environmental manipulation to reduce opportunities for nail-biting. Keep hands occupied with activities like knitting, doodling, or fidgeting with a tactile object. For those on Lexapro, combining this with mindfulness practices—such as deep breathing or progressive muscle relaxation—can address underlying anxiety that may fuel the habit. Nail-biting is not a recognized or documented side effect of Lexapro (escitalopram). It is an SSRI (selective serotonin reuptake inhibitor) primarily used to treat depression and anxiety, and its side effects typically include nausea, insomnia, or headaches, not habitual behaviors like nail-biting.

Lexapro does not directly cause nervous habits such as nail-biting. However, if someone is experiencing increased anxiety or restlessness as a side effect of the medication, they might engage in habits like nail-biting as a coping mechanism.

While Lexapro itself does not cause nail-biting, some individuals may develop or worsen nervous habits if the medication temporarily increases anxiety or restlessness during the adjustment period. If this occurs, consult a healthcare provider for guidance.
